🌟【水平滚动效果怎么实现?最新教程+代码案例】💻网站优化必看!SEO友好型设计指南📈
一、为什么水平滚动效果是网站优化的关键?
✅ 移动端用户占比超70%(百度数据)
✅ 水平滚动能提升页面停留时间23%(Google Analytics)
✅ 符合"Z世代"浏览习惯的交互设计
二、水平滚动4大实现方案(附代码)
1️⃣ 原生滚动方案(基础版)
```html
```
🛠️ 优化要点:
- 添加`overflow-x: auto`控制滚动范围
- 使用`-webkit-overflow-scrolling: touch`提升移动端体验
- 添加`white-space: nowrap`保持元素紧凑
2️⃣ CSS3动画方案(高级版)
```css
.items {
display: flex;
gap: 20px;
transition: transform 0.5s cubic-bezier(0.25, 0.46, 0.45, 0.94);
padding: 20px 0;
overflow-x: hidden;
}
.items:hover {
transform: translateX(-50px);
}
```
💡 SEO技巧:
- 使用`transform`替代`left`定位(提升兼容性)
- 添加`touch-action: pan-x`增强触屏响应
- 添加`-webkit-tap-highlight-color: transparent`消除点击高亮
3️⃣ Swiper框架方案(专业版)
```html
```
📊 性能数据:
- 页面加载速度提升40%(Lighthouse评分92+)
- 内存占用降低35%
- 支持320-2560px自适应
4️⃣ WebGL动态方案(炫酷版)
```glsl
version 300 es
uniform float u_time;
out vec4 FragColor;
void main() {
vec2 pos = gl_FragCoord.xy - vec2(0.5);
float angle = atan(pos.x, pos.y) + u_time * 0.1;
vec3 col = vec3(abs(sin(angle)));
FragColor = vec4(col, 1.0);
}
```
🔧
- 添加`will-change: transform`提升渲染性能
- 使用`requestAnimationFrame`控制帧率
- 添加`position: fixed`实现全屏覆盖
三、SEO优化必做5件事
1️⃣ 结构化数据标记
```html
{
"@context": "https://schema.org",
"@type": "WebPage",
"name": "水平滚动效果教程",
"description": "最新水平滚动方案+SEO优化指南"
}
```
2️⃣ 图片优化技巧
- 使用WebP格式(体积减少30%)
- 添加`loading: lazy`延迟加载
- 为图片添加`alt`文本(SEO关键词植入)
3️⃣ 语义化标签重构
```html
```
4️⃣ 加速优化组合拳
- 启用HTTP/2(首字节时间降低50%)
- 添加Brotli压缩(体积减少25%)
- 使用CDN加速(全球访问速度提升60%)
5️⃣ 移动端适配要点
- 添加`meta viewport`(推荐`width=device-width`)
- 滚动区域宽度自动适配屏幕
- 添加`-webkit-overflow-scrolling: touch`
四、常见问题解决方案
Q1:滚动条显示导致页面美观?
✅ 解决方案:
- 添加`&::-webkit-scrollbar { display: none }`
- 使用CSS变量控制滚动条颜色
- 采用弹性滚动方案(如Taro框架)
Q2:滚动卡顿影响体验?
🔧 优化步骤:
1. 添加`transform: translate3d(0,0,0)`
2. 使用`requestAnimationFrame`控制渲染
3. 添加`will-change: transform`标记
4. 减少DOM节点数量(<50个/屏)
Q3:SEO排名不升反降?
❗ 检查项:
- 检查`Google Mobile-Friendly Test`
- 分析`Search Console`的移动端表现
- 使用`PageSpeed Insights`优化加载速度
- 检查是否出现`JavaScript rendered page`错误
五、未来趋势预测
1️⃣ 智能滚动(预测)
- 基于用户停留时间的自动切换
- 结合LBS的地理滚动效果
- AI生成动态滚动内容
2️⃣ 性能新标准
- WebGPU技术普及(渲染性能提升300%)
- 网页滚动延迟控制在50ms以内
- 内存占用低于50MB
3️⃣ SEO新维度
- 滚动交互时长纳入排名因素
- 触控热图分析纳入评估体系
- 多端一致性体验权重提升
📝 文章
通过4种主流实现方案+5大SEO优化策略,配合最新技术趋势分析,完整覆盖从基础实现到专业优化的全链路。建议每月使用`Google PageSpeed Insights`监测性能,每季度进行`Core Web Vitals`优化,持续提升网站竞争力。
(全文共计1287字,阅读时长约8分钟)


